Did you know that the Black Soldier Fly (BSF) is a game-changer in waste management and sustainable agriculture? One BSF larva can consume up to twice its body weight in organic waste daily, reducing waste volumes by over 50%! Plus, the larvae produce nutrient-rich frass (organic manure) that enhances soil health, while also serving as a protein-packed feed for livestock. Agricultural pollutants are a significant concern affecting farmers, nearby residents, and environmental regulators. These unpleasant smell is generated by a variety of agricultural activities, including livestock rearing, compost management, crop cultivation, and pesticide application. To mitigate these issues, odour monitoring has become crucial. By installing smart odour monitoring systems, farmers can identify the specific sources of these odours and implement strategies to reduce them. This not only improves air quality but also enhances the relationship between agricultural operations and surrounding communities. As urbanization expands and environmental consciousness grows, the demand for effective odour management on farms is escalating. 🧐 Did You Know? Microplastics, plastic particles less than 5mm in size, are infiltrating our agricultural soils. They come from plastic mulch, treated sewage sludge, and even fertilizers, impacting soil health, crop growth, and food safety.
